Our preference: Short positions below 92.4 with targets @ 89.5 & 87 in extension.
Alternative scenario: Above 92.4 look for further upside with 96 & 98 as targets.
Comment: the pair has struck against its resistance and is facing a weakness, the RSI is mixed to bearish.
